关于XILINX 中动态配置时钟模块 MMCME2_ADV

46 篇文章 8 订阅
29 篇文章 7 订阅

kindly(773566320) 下午 9:20:08

@ 李工 李工 ,你弄过 sp6 的动态锁相环吗 

GaN(1009757565) 下午 9:21:28

@kindly Demo板,我拿来验证寄存器设置。

kindly(773566320) 下午 9:22:10

噢,哦 

 李工(715713994) 下午 9:22:25

@kindly 没有,只是看过,没实际搞过

 李工(715713994) 下午 9:22:39

用SPI总线配置吧,动态配置。

kindly(773566320) 下午 9:20:08
@ 李工 李工 ,你弄过 sp6 的动态锁相环吗 
GaN(1009757565) 下午 9:21:28
@kindly Demo板,我拿来验证寄存器设置。
kindly(773566320) 下午 9:22:10
噢,哦 
 李工(715713994) 下午 9:22:25
@kindly 没有,只是看过,没实际搞过
 李工(715713994) 下午 9:22:39
用SPI总线配置吧,动态配置。

 

 

qq群号 :414371872

这个错误信息表明,您的设计使用的时钟频率计算值超出了Xilinx器件的MMCM VCO频率的操作范围。具体来说,计算得到的VCO操作频率为500.000 MHz,而该器件的MMCM VCO频率的操作范围为600.000 - 1440.000 MHz。 要解决这个问题,有几种可能的方法: 1. 更新MMCM设置:按照错误信息提到的建议,可以运行"update_timing"命令来更新MMCM设置。这个命令会根据当前的时钟约束和时序分析结果,自动调整MMCM的参数以确保VCO频率在操作范围内。 2. 调整输入周期:您可以尝试调整输入时钟的周期(CLKINx_PERIOD),使得计算得到的VCO频率在操作范围内。根据错误信息,当前的输入周期为10.000 ns。您可以根据需要适当增加或减小该值,然后新运行时序分析和生成比特流文件。 3. 调整乘法因子和除法因子:另一个调整的选项是修改乘法因子(CLKFBOUT_MULT_F)和除法因子(DIVCLK_DIVIDE)。您可以根据实际需求适当增加或减小这两个因子的值,以使得计算得到的VCO频率在操作范围内。 需要注意的是,调整这些参数可能会对设计的时序和性能产生影响,因此在进行更改之前,建议您仔细评估和分析设计的需求和约束。另外,确保您的时钟源和外部电路也能够支持所需的时钟频率范围。 如果上述方法仍然无法解决问题,建议您参考Xilinx官方文档、用户指南和相关社区资源,以获取更详细的指导和支持。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值